在计算机中,软件源(Software Source)指的是软件包的发布和分发位置,通常是一组由软件开发者或社区维护的服务器或存储库。软件源包含了软件包的二进制文件、源代码、文档等资源,用户可以通过软件源来获取和安装软件包。
软件源可以分为官方软件源和第三方软件源两种类型:
-
官方软件源:由操作系统的官方维护者或者软件开发者所维护的软件源。例如,在Ubuntu系统中,官方软件源由Canonical公司维护。官方软件源通常包含了操作系统的核心组件和一些常用的软件包。
-
第三方软件源:由其他组织或个人维护的软件源。第三方软件源通常包含一些官方软件源没有的软件包或者更新版本的软件包。例如,在Ubuntu系统中,常用的第三方软件源有PPA(Personal Package Archive)。PPA是由Ubuntu社区的用户维护的软件源,包含了许多常用的软件包。
通过配置软件源,用户可以方便地获取和安装软件包。在Linux系统中,常用的软件源管理工具有apt、yum、dnf等,可以通过这些工具来添加、删除、更新和搜索软件源。
需要注意的是,软件源的安全性和可靠性对于系统的稳定性和安全性至关重要。用户应该谨慎选择软件源,并确保软件源的来源可靠和可信。
总之,软件源是软件包的发布和分发位置,用户可以通过软件源来获取和安装软件包,是计算机系统中非常重要的一部分。
常用的中文软件源社区:
在Linux系统中,中文软件源社区提供了许多常用的软件包和工具,可以方便用户下载和安装常用软件。下面介绍一些常见的中文软件源社区。
-
阿里云开源镜像站: (阿里巴巴开源镜像站-OPSX镜像站-阿里云开发者社区)阿里云开源镜像站是一个提供各种常用软件包和工具的开源镜像站,包括CentOS、Ubuntu、Debian、openSUSE、Fedora等多个发行版的软件包。
-
清华大学开源软件镜像站: (清华大学开源软件镜像站 | Tsinghua Open Source Mirror)清华大学开源软件镜像站是一个提供各种常用软件包和工具的开源镜像站,包括CentOS、Ubuntu、Debian、openSUSE、Fedora等多个发行版的软件包。
-
中科大开源镜像站:(USTC Open Source Software Mirror)中科大开源镜像站是中国科学技术大学提供的一个开源镜像站,提供各种常用软件包和工具,包括CentOS、Ubuntu、Debian、openSUSE、Fedora等多个发行版的软件包。
-
网易开源镜像站:(欢迎访问网易开源镜像站)网易开源镜像站是一个提供各种开源软件包和工具的镜像站,包括CentOS、Ubuntu、Debian、openSUSE、Fedora等多个发行版的软件包。
需要注意的是,不同的中文软件源社区可能存在略微不同的软件包和版本,用户需要根据自己的需要选择合适的软件源。此外,在使用软件源时应当注意安全性,避免下载和安装来路不明的软件包和工具。